How to Choose the Right Bladeless Floor Fan

Choosing the right bladeless floor fan involves considering several features to ensure it meets your specific needs and preferences. While bladeless fans offer a modern aesthetic and enhanced safety, understanding their capabilities beyond appearances is crucial. Here’s a breakdown of key factors to consider:

Airflow & Coverage

The primary function of a fan is to circulate air, and bladeless fans vary significantly in their airflow power. Look for fans that advertise CFM (Cubic Feet per Minute) or ft/s (feet per second) – higher numbers generally indicate stronger airflow. Consider the size of the room you intend to cool; smaller rooms (under 200 sq ft) may only need a basic model, while larger spaces (500+ sq ft) will benefit from fans with wider oscillation (90° or 180°) and more powerful motors. Some models, like the DREAME MF10, utilize technologies like ‘GyroWing’ to enhance air circulation throughout the room, reducing hot and cold spots. Stronger airflow translates to faster cooling and greater comfort, especially in warmer climates.

Noise Level

Bladeless fans are often marketed as being quieter than traditional fans, but noise levels can still vary. Pay attention to the decibel (dB) rating, especially if you plan to use the fan in a bedroom or home office. Fans with dB ratings below 30dB are considered very quiet and suitable for sleep. Features like optimized impeller designs (as found in the DREO 2026) and DC motors contribute to quieter operation. Lower noise levels mean you can enjoy a cool breeze without disruption.

Smart Features & Control Options

Many modern bladeless fans offer smart features like WiFi connectivity, app control, and voice assistant compatibility. These features allow you to control the fan remotely, set schedules, and integrate it into your smart home ecosystem. The DREO WiFi Smart Bladeless Fan and similar models give you access to these conveniences. Consider if these features are important to you and how likely you are to use them. Beyond smart controls, assess the ease of use of the included remote control and the intuitiveness of any on-unit touch panels.

Additional Features

  • Air Purification: Some models, like the ULTTY fan, integrate HEPA filters to purify the air while circulating it. This is a great option for allergy sufferers or those concerned about indoor air quality.
  • Mode Variety: Different modes (Normal, Natural, Sleep, Auto) offer customized cooling experiences. Auto mode, which adjusts fan speed based on ambient temperature, can be particularly convenient.
  • Oscillation Range: Wider oscillation angles (180° like the Shark TF202S) provide more comprehensive room coverage.
  • LED Lighting: Some fans, like the MEPTY model, include built-in LED lights, adding extra functionality.
  • Ease of Cleaning: Bladeless designs are generally easier to clean than traditional fans, but look for models with easily removable filters and grilles.

FAQs

What is a bladeless floor fan and how does it work?

A bladeless floor fan doesn’t have visible blades. Instead, it uses an impeller hidden in the base to draw air in and then forces it out through a small gap, creating a smooth, consistent airflow. This technology offers a safer and more aesthetically pleasing cooling solution.

How do I choose the right size bladeless fan for my room?

Consider the room’s square footage. Smaller rooms (under 200 sq ft) can benefit from basic models, while larger spaces (500+ sq ft) require fans with higher CFM (Cubic Feet per Minute) and wider oscillation angles (90° – 180°) for effective air circulation.

Are bladeless fans really quieter than traditional fans?

Generally, yes. Bladeless fans tend to be quieter because they lack the mechanical noise associated with traditional fan blades. However, noise levels vary; look for models with a decibel (dB) rating below 30dB for very quiet operation.

What are the benefits of a bladeless floor fan with air purification?

Some floor fan models integrate HEPA filters, offering the dual benefit of air circulation and air purification. This is ideal for those with allergies or sensitivities, as it removes dust, pollen, and other airborne particles while cooling the room.
